Lincoln County, North Carolina is a rural county located in the western part of the state. It is known for its beautiful landscapes, small town charm, and affordable cost of living. The population in this county is around 85,000 and it has been experiencing steady growth in recent years.
Lincoln County, North Carolina is a popular place to live for those looking for a slower pace of life and a strong sense of community.
